Hinota Population - Vidisha, Madhya Pradesh

Hinota is a small village located in Tyonda Tehsil of Vidisha district, Madhya Pradesh with total 19 families residing. The Hinota village has population of 105 of which 57 are males while 48 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Hinota village population of children with age 0-6 is 13 which makes up 12.38 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hinota village is 842 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Hinota as per census is 1600,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.

Hinota village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Hinota village was 79.35 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Hinota Male literacy stands at 96.15 % while female literacy rate was 57.50 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 4.76 % of total population in Hinota village. The village Hinota curr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Hinota village out of total population, 61 were engaged in work activities. 55.74 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 44.26 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 61 workers engaged in Main Work, 26 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 7 were Agricultural labourer.
